Carried over from #43:

There's a fair amount of clean-ups to do here:

  • update python
    - python=3.8
  • unpin pandas
  • remove cell outputs from what's committed (e.g. using nbstripout git hooks)
  • ensure all the notebooks are still runnable, produce useful output (alternatively, remove)
  • One other thing I noticed [in count_downloads.py] is that we're doing a lot of pointless downloading - recalculating the download numbers from 2017-2023 is a waste of time, because (now that the .conda stats are in), they should be fully static. We should implement some basic persistence (with an override if we really want to recalculate everything), which would allow us to cut down the downloads to the last few months, rather than currently 8*12=96 (and growing), which takes over half an hour (in binder).
